The raw data contained in a TLS certificate.

+ +

For X.509 certificates (CertificateType + = "x509"), this MUST be in DER format, as defined by the + X.690 + ITU standard.

+ +

For PGP certificates (CertificateType + = "pgp"), this MUST be a binary OpenPGP key as defined by section 11.1 + of RFC 4880.

If the State is Rejected, + the reason why the certificate was rejected; this MAY correspond to + the RejectReason, or MAY be a more + specific D-Bus error name, perhaps implementation-specific.

+

If the State is not Rejected, + this property is not meaningful, and SHOULD be set to an empty + string.

If the State is Rejected, + additional information about why the certificate was rejected.

+

If the State is not Rejected, + this property is not meaningful and SHOULD be set to an empty + map.

+

The additional information MAY also include + one or more of the following well-known keys:

+
+
user-requested (b)
+
True if the error was due to an user-requested rejection of + the certificate; False if there was an unrecoverable error in the + verification process.
+
expected-hostname (s)
+
If the rejection reason is Hostname_Mismatch, the hostname that + the server certificate was expected to have.
+
certificate-hostname (s)
+
If the rejection reason is Hostname_Mismatch, the hostname of + the certificate that was presented. + +

For instance, if you try to connect to gmail.com but are presented + with a TLS certificate issued to evil.example.org, the error details + for Hostname_Mismatch MAY include:

+
+	      {
+	        'expected-hostname': 'gmail.com',
+	        'certificate-hostname': 'evil.example.org',
+	      }

A channel type that carries a TLS certificate between a server + and a client connecting to it.

+

Channels of this kind always have Requested = False, + TargetHandleType + = None and TargetHandle + = 0, and cannot be requested with methods such as CreateChannel. + Also, they SHOULD be dispatched while the + Connection + owning them is in the CONNECTING state.

In this case, handlers SHOULD accept or reject the certificate, using - the relevant methods on the provided object, or MAY just close the channel before doing so, to fall + the relevant methods on the provided object, or MAY just Close the channel before doing so, to fall back to a non-interactive verification process done inside the CM.

For example, channels of this kind can pop up while a client is connecting to an XMPP server.
